sex-negative

English

Adjective

sex-negative (comparative more sex-negative, superlative most sex-negative)

  1. Having a generally negative view of sexuality; seeking to repress and control libido.
    Antonym: sex-positive
    • 2012, Richard McAnulty, editor, Sex in College: The Things They Don't Write Home About, ABC-CLIO, →ISBN, page 246:
      In North America, sexual values tend to be sex-negative and thus contribute to the development of sexual difficulties.
